I picked this S-K set up today at a local antiques shop. The metal label inside the case reads S-K TOOLS Chicago, Ill 60632
Its a 1/4" Drive Metric set with a 40 tooth round head ratchet wrench marked S-K USA 45170 USA on one side and Pat. No. 2232477 on the other side.
All the sockets are 6-point type with dual line band in 300 series starting with 7m/m and continuing with, 8, 9, 10, 11, 12, 13 m/m then skips to 15 m/m and a 17m/m.
Included is a short extension #45159 S-K USA and a 13/16 Spark plug socket # 4426 S-K USA.
How old is this set and what pieces are missing/needed to complete?

S-K changed their HQ to Franklin Park in early 1971. So, your box is 1969 to 1971.
